Edu Tognon

A função SOMASES, que faz parte das funções condicionais do Excel, é muito utilizada para realizar soma de valores com base em uma ou mais condições. Como ela aceita diferentes formatos de dados e também inúmeras possibilidades de condições e operações dentro dessas condições, podemos criar uma infinidade de somas condicionais com ela (inclusive associando-a a outras funções).

Neste artigo, você entenderá os conceitos básicos e a sintaxe da SOMASES, bem como em quais ocasiões ela pode ser utilizada. Diferentemente da função SOMASE, a SOMASES permite uma quantidade infinita de critérios cumulativos, por isso sua sintaxe é “invertida” em relação à sua colega. Vamos aprender um pouco mais sobre ela?

Versão em vídeo

Versão do Excel utilizada na aula: Microsoft Excel Professional Plus [versão 2019]

Download dos arquivos

Você pode baixar os arquivos utilizados no tutorial em vídeo. O arquivo inicial refere-se ao arquivo sem as modificações, ideal para praticar o passo a passo e treinar suas habilidades. O arquivo pronto é o arquivo final, com todas as modificações ensinadas já aplicadas, ideal se você já quiser ter em mãos o resultado. 

Para baixar os arquivos, acesse a página de download e clique no botão Baixar

Versão em texto / ilustrada

Versão do Excel utilizada neste tutorial: Microsoft Excel 365 [versão 2201]

Aprenda o que quiser. Milhares de cursos incríveis para escolher.

Dicas e informações complementares

  • Lembre-se de que a sintaxe da função SOMASES é diferente da SOMASE. Enquanto na SOMASE você define os critérios para, só depois, definir o intervalo de soma (até porque essa função lida com apenas uma condição), na SOMASES você define seu intervalo de soma para, só então, definir seus critérios, já que você pode definir diversos critérios ao mesmo tempo.
  • A função SOMASES é cumulativa em seus critérios, ou seja, ela apenas somará os valores se eles corresponderem a TODOS os critérios ao mesmo tempo, e não a um ou a outro.
  • Caso queira contar a quantidade de ocorrências de determinados dados de acordo com uma condição, as funções ideais são a CONT.SE (para uma única condição) e a CONT.SES (para uma ou mais condições).